Gauri Kamalini – The Divine Lotus Drape
Gauri Collection – A Modern Tribute to Ancient Grace
Named after the lotus—Kamalini, a symbol of divine beauty and strength—this saree is a quiet celebration of feminine power wrapped in tradition. With its vibrant blend of Sungudi-inspired patterns and Kalamkari-style temple artistry, Gauri Kamalini evokes the spirit of South Indian heritage, reimagined for the modern woman.
The deep teal body of the saree blooms with hand-drawn-style figures and folk scenes, reminiscent of ancient murals and village life. A striking contrast rust-red pallu and an intricately woven zari border elevate this drape with a touch of royal grandeur, making it perfect for festive rituals, weddings, and cultural gatherings.
Product Features
✅ Fabric: Premium Art Silk – smooth, graceful, and rich in feel
✅ Design: Kalamkari-inspired temple and folk motifs with Sungudi influence
✅ Border: Zari-woven gold design with intricate detailing
✅ Color Palette: Teal green with rust-red and antique gold highlights
✅ Length: 5.5 metres saree + 0.8 metre unstitched blouse piece
✅ Occasion: Perfect for traditional functions, temple visits, and festive occasions
✅ Care: Dry clean only to preserve artwork and zari finish
